About Life Insurance Law in Dedham, United States:

Life insurance law in Dedham, United States governs the rights and responsibilities of policyholders, beneficiaries, and insurance companies in the context of life insurance policies. These laws regulate aspects such as policy terms, coverage limits, premiums, beneficiary designations, and claims procedures.

Frequently Asked Questions:

1. What types of life insurance are available in Dedham, United States?

In Dedham, United States, common types of life insurance include term life, whole life, universal life, and variable life insurance policies.

2. How do I choose the right life insurance policy for me?

Choosing the right life insurance policy depends on your financial goals, budget, and coverage needs. It is advisable to consult with a licensed insurance agent or financial advisor to assess your options.

3. Can my life insurance claim be denied?

Your life insurance claim can be denied for reasons such as policy exclusions, misrepresentations on the application, or lapsed premiums. If your claim is denied, you have the right to appeal the decision or seek legal counsel.

4. What should I do if I suspect life insurance fraud?

If you suspect life insurance fraud, you should report your concerns to the insurance company's fraud department or the state insurance regulatory authority in Dedham, United States.

5. Can I change the beneficiary on my life insurance policy?

You can typically change the beneficiary on your life insurance policy by submitting a beneficiary change form to the insurance company. It is essential to ensure that the change is documented and acknowledged by the insurer.

6. What should I do if my life insurance policy lapses?

If your life insurance policy lapses due to missed premium payments, you may have options to reinstate the policy by paying the overdue premiums or converting it to a different type of policy. Consult with your insurance company for guidance.

7. How does the life insurance claims process work?

The life insurance claims process involves submitting a claim form, providing supporting documentation, and waiting for the insurance company to review and approve the claim. If there are any issues with the claim, you may need to engage legal assistance.

8. Are there any tax implications of life insurance benefits in Dedham, United States?

In general, life insurance benefits are not taxable in Dedham, United States. However, there may be exceptions for certain situations, such as policies with investment components or sizable estates. It is advisable to consult with a tax professional for personalized advice.

9. Can I cancel my life insurance policy at any time?

You can typically cancel your life insurance policy at any time by contacting your insurance company and following their cancellation procedures. Be aware of any potential penalties or fees associated with early policy termination.
